The fishing of the catfish, one of the most impressive freshwater fish in Europe, requires true power that necessitates specific equipment, especially when engaging in still-fishing, and it necessitates a specific rod among all catfish rods. This fishing method breaks down into several techniques, like live bait fishing, buoy fishing, or pellet fishing for example

Live bait fishing: This technique involves using a live fish as bait. For this, a sturdy and robust rod is necessary, capable of withstanding the violent attacks of the catfish. This fishing is practiced from the bank, or from a boat with drifting floats.

Buoy fishing: For this method, the bait is suspended under a buoy. It requires a rod with a sensitive enough tip to detect the strike, while having the sturdiness necessary to fight the biggest catfishes.

Pellet fishing: Here, pellets or grains are used as bait. This is very similar to carp battery fishing, with obviously more robust equipment.

Other still-fishing for catfish: Many other baits and techniques can be considered, such as poultry offal, squid, dead fish, etc. You can place the baits on bottom lines with or without a float to vary the presentation.

How to choose my still-fishing catfish rod?

Fishing from the bank or on a boat: casting from the bank will necessarily require a long and powerful rod, as you have to reach the spot by casting a lead + 1 rig + 1 bait, which can easily reach 300 grams or more. If you are fishing on a boat, however, a 240cm rod will be enough for live bait fishing for example. The same from the bank live, as a boat is often needed to position, a “short” rod of 240 to 260 cm will also be enough, unless you have obstacles on the bank that require fish control. However, on a boat without a float, it would be preferable to direct you to a vertical catfish rod which will be shorter and more suitable. There are also casting catfish rods that are designed for buoy fishing, do not hesitate to take a look. Finally, for the lure you will direct yourself to a more suitable rod here: lure catfish fishing rod.

Power: choosing the power is a balance as often it indicates both the casting capacity and the ability to fight large or very large fish. It can be said that the “light” catfish rods, those for targeting fish under about 2 meters, will be between 200 and 400 grams. Then the rods above 400 grams will be more targeted at large fish. Of course, it is possible to pull out huge catfish with a light rod, but naturally in the presence of obstacles or current this will be slightly less easy than with a perfectly adapted rod.

Brands and budget: "Black Cat", "Dam MadCat", and "Penn Legion Cat" are leading brands in this field. But newcomers are also very well placed like Zeck or Unicat. In any case, these brands offer several ranges and you can equip yourself for even a modest budget.
